Seven novels about women over 40

Colleen Oakley is the USA Today bestselling author of six novels including, The Mostly True Story of Tanner & Louise, The Invisible Husband of Frick Island, You Were There Too, Close Enough to Touch, Before I Go, and her latest Jane and Dan at the End of the World.

[The Page 69 Test: Before I Go; Writers Read: Colleen Oakley (January 2015); Writers Read: Colleen Oakley (March 2017)]

At Electric Lit Oakley tagged seven novels featuring "protagonists over the age of 40—women navigating the complexities of middle life with all its triumphs, heartbreaks, and reinventions." One title on the list:
Tom Lake by Ann Patchett

Ann Patchett’s latest engrossing novel is about a 57-year-old mother who finally tells the story of her once-upon-a-time love affair with a famous Hollywood star to her three grown daughters. It’s poignant, introspective and beautifully nostalgic.
